Tag C#
Tìm kiếm bài viết trong Tag C#
Cách chạy các tác vụ đồng thời bằng Thread và Task trong C#.
Trong C#, bạn có thể chạy nhiều tác vụ đồng thời bằng cách sử dụng các tiến trình (threads) hoặc các tác vụ (tasks). Dưới đây là hai cách tiêu biểu để thực hiện điều này:.
0 0 21
Từ khóa stackalloc trong C#
Trong ngôn ngữ lập trình C#, stackalloc là một từ khóa được sử dụng để cấp phát một mảng dữ liệu trên ngăn xếp (stack) thay vì trên heap. Ngăn xếp là một khu vực nhớ tạm thời trong bộ nhớ được sử dụng
0 0 19
Span<T> trong C#
Span<T> là một phần của System.Memory namespace trong C# và được giới thiệu từ C# 7.
0 0 11
Hardware Intrinsics trong .NET Core
Hardware Intrinsics là một tính năng mạnh mẽ trong .NET Core (và .
0 0 17
Tuple trong C#
Trong C#, tuple là một cấu trúc dữ liệu cho phép bạn lưu trữ và truy cập một tập hợp các giá trị khác nhau trong một đối tượng duy nhất, mà không cần tạo một lớp hoặc struct riêng biệt. Tuples thường
0 0 12
Iterators trong C#.
Trong C#, "iterators" là một tính năng cho phép bạn duyệt qua các phần tử của một tập hợp hoặc một tập hợp các phần tử một cách tuần tự mà không cần phải tạo một danh sách hoặc mảng mới để lưu trữ tất
0 0 15
từ khóa goto trong C#.
Trong C#, từ khóa goto được sử dụng để thực hiện một nhảy không điều kiện từ một điểm trong mã đến một nhãn (label) khác trong cùng phạm vi (scope). goto cho phép bạn thực hiện những nhảy điểm tới một
0 0 14
Từ khóa fixed trong C#.
Trong C#, từ khóa fixed được sử dụng để giới hạn một biến có kiểu con trỏ (pointer) trong một khối mã (block) và đảm bảo rằng biến đó không thay đổi địa chỉ của con trỏ khi chương trình đang chạy, giú
0 0 14
So sánh Dapper và Entity Framework trong .NET
Dapper và Entity Framework (EF) là hai thư viện phổ biến được sử dụng trong lập trình .NET để làm việc với cơ sở dữ liệu.
0 0 18
Nên sử dụng IDisposable trong C# ?
Trong C#, bạn nên kế thừa interface IDisposable cho một class khi class đó sử dụng tài nguyên không quản lý như tệp tin, socket, cơ sở dữ liệu, hoặc bất kỳ tài nguyên nào cần được giải phóng một cách
0 0 18
Model Binding trong ASP .NET
Model binding là một khái niệm trong lập trình ứng dụng web, đặc biệt là trong các framework phát triển web như ASP.NET.
0 0 19
Sử dụng delegate trong C#
Trong C#, delegate là một loại dữ liệu kiểu tham chiếu (reference type) cho phép bạn truyền các phương thức (methods) như một tham số, lưu trữ chúng trong biến, và gọi chúng tại các thời điểm sau này.
0 0 18
Vấn đề Memory Leak và OutOfMemory trong C#
Hôm nay mình có được một anh Tech Lead của một công ty hỏi về vấn đề Memory Leak và OutOfMemory trong C#, giờ chúng ta sẽ tìm hiểu về hai khái niệm này nhé. .
0 0 22
Tìm hiểu về HTTP/1.x, HTTP/2 và HTTP/3?
Vào một ngày đẹp trời năm 2021, mình có ứng tuyển vào một công ty C..., công ty này chỉ có một vòng duy nhất phỏng vấn. Khi mình đang demo con app sịn sò của mình và request ra sao thì xuất hiện 3 req
0 0 24
Sự khác nhau giữa string và StringBuilder
Trong C#, string và StringBuilder là hai lớp thông được dùng để lưu trữ và thao tác với chuỗi, tuy nhiên bạn đã biết đặc điểm khác biệt của hai lớp này chưa? Khi nào sử dụng string và khi nào sử dụng
0 0 20
Hướng dẫn load một phần trong trang (partial view) mà không reload lại trang dùng jQuery
Trong app MVC đôi khi chúng ta muốn thay đổi một phần trong trang (page) mà không muốn phải reload (refresh) lại trang đó thì chúng ta có thể dùng kĩ thuật Ajax để load dữ liệu sau đó dùng javascript
0 0 21
Khi nào sử dung LinQ <query> tốt hơn dùng LinQ <method>
Thật lòng mà nói, LinQ vô cùng bá đạo, mạnh mẽ linh hoạt và đẹp đẽ. Mình yêu nó ngay từ cái nhìn đầu tiên, mình nghĩ các bạn cũng sẽ như vậy thôi .
0 0 25
Series viết code sao cho cool ngầu (Phần 2)
Ở bài viết trước trong series, mình đã chia sẻ 5 tips code cool ngầu. 6. Dùng lamda. Normal.
0 0 18
Series viết code sao cho cool ngầu (Phần 1)
Mở đầu. Có một câu mà mình luôn luôn giữ nó trong đầu: "Technical solve old problems and introduces new".
0 0 16
Một số lưu ý khi sử dụng Linq trong C#
Hi anh em, chúc mọi người một ngày làm việc hiệu quả và đây năng lượng. Hôm nay mình sẽ nói về một số kinh nghiệm của mình khi làm việc với LINQ C#.
0 0 23